Speaker formats
Keynote Sessions
High-impact sessions from senior leaders and recognised experts addressing strategic questions shaping Europe’s supply chain future.
Executive Case Studies
Practical examples from organisations navigating resilience, digitalisation, sustainability, transformation, talent, or strategic autonomy.
Panel Discussions
Moderated conversations bringing together senior perspectives from industry, policy, technology, logistics, and innovation ecosystems.
Roundtables
Small-group peer discussions where leaders compare approaches, challenge assumptions, and explore practical decision pathways.
Workshops & Parallel Sessions
Interactive sessions focused on tools, frameworks, implementation lessons, operating models, and applied learning.
What we look for
A clear supply chain challenge or strategic decision
Practical examples, evidence, or lessons learned
Strong speaker proposals should help participants think differently and act more effectively. We prioritise contributions that are practical, relevant, original, and useful for a senior professional audience.
Relevance for senior professionals and decision-makers
Connection to one or more CSCMP EDGE Europe 2027 themes
Actionable takeaways for participants
Balanced perspective on opportunities, risks, and implementation realities
Commercial sales pitches will not be prioritised. Sponsor-related contributions should focus on insight, value creation, and practical learning rather than product promotion.
